Both parents show extreme aggression towards intruders in order to protect their young. During their first week after hatching, only the female will feed the young through regurgitation, afterwards the male will also feed the young.

  • Range age at sexual or reproductive maturity (male) 3 to 4 yearsīlue-and-yellow macaw males and females care for their young through providing for them and protecting them.
  • Range age at sexual or reproductive maturity (female) 3 to 4 years.
  • Range time to independence 10 (low) days.
  • Breeding season Blue-and-yellow macaws breed from January through July.
  • Breeding interval Blue-and-yellow macaws breed every 1 to 2 years.
  • gonochoric/gonochoristic/dioecious (sexes separate).
  • Within 3 months fledglings become independent. After 10 days the young begin to develop feathers. Females lay 2 to 3 eggs and incubate them for 24 to 28 days, after which the young hatch blind and featherless. Nests are found high up in tall trees, mainly in cavities already made by other animals. Their breeding season is during the first half of the year and they breed about every 1 to 2 years.

    Their eyes are yellow and their facial area consists of bare white skin with several black feather lines around their eyes. Their under-wing coverts and breast are yellow-orange and they have black beaks, throat, and legs. They are vibrantly colored, with blue on their backs and wings, yellow under parts, green forehead feathers, and green tips on the end of their wings. ( Juniper, 1998)īlue-and-yellow macaws are from 81 to 91.5 cm long, weigh from 0.9 to 1.8 kg, and have a wing span of 104 to 114 cm. They nest high in trees to avoid predation. ( Juniper, 1998)īlue-and-yellow macaws are found mainly in rainforests in swampy and riparian areas. Blue-and-yellow macaws are also found in Mexico and are restricted to Panama in Central America.

    Ara ararauna (blue-and-yellow macaws) can be found throughout subtropical and tropical forests, woodlands, and savannas in South America from Venezuela to Brazil, Bolivia, Colombia and Paraguay.
